2,200 baboon-proof bins headed for Cape Peninsula homes

Starting mid-September 2026, 2,200 of the 6,000 lockable baboon-proof bins will be rolled out in priority areas of the Cape Peninsula, where conflicts with residents have been reported frequently. The first areas to receive the new bins include Plateau Road, Castle Rock, and Tokai East. A northern boundary fence project is also underway to prevent baboons from entering urban and farmland areas, with the process expected to begin later in September.
